How long does it take to build?
For a straightforward site you are usually looking at a few weeks. The build is rarely the bottleneck; getting the text and photography together almost always is.
Is WordPress secure enough for a business site?
Yes, provided it is maintained. Most problems come from outdated plugins and weak passwords rather than from WordPress itself. That is exactly what ongoing maintenance covers.
Can you rebuild my existing site instead of starting over?
Often, yes. If the foundation is sound, improving structure, speed and content usually beats starting from scratch. When the system is outdated or slow at its core, rebuilding works out cheaper than patching.
